As Salko says, make a wood block, with one end cut at 15°. Clamp the block to your workpiece so the 15° angle is at the edge of your mortise. Use it as a guide to get the proper angle.
Of course, much of the mortise could be cut the usual way, but getting the ends at the proper angle will require the jig.
